用AT89C2051内部的比较器做ADC转换,AD转换,分辨率12位,稳定度8位,做平均值后可提高。

2020-01-19 19:41发布

放假做恒温烙铁,另一研究部分:用AT89C2051的内部比较器做廉价ADC 。
    电路图:

(原文件名:AD转换测试原理图.PNG)

    焊接实验板成品:

(原文件名:AD 1.JPG)


(原文件名:AD 2.JPG)

    程序:
点击此处下载 ourdev_543560.pdf(文件大小:53K) (原文件名:at89c2051 ADC test.pdf)
    视频:wmv格式,为了上传,改成AVI后缀,因此如果双击打不开,请改后缀
点击此处下载 ourdev_543561.AVI视频文件大小:1.39M) (原文件名:AT89C2051 ADC.AVI)
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
81条回答
oufuqiang
1楼-- · 2020-01-23 00:46
 精彩回答 2  元偷偷看……
zhangjinxing
2楼-- · 2020-01-23 05:19
是不错,不过有几点误差
1,9012三极管恒流的线性度误差,就是在ce由12v变为6v左右输出恒流的线性度,不过楼主在E接了负反馈电阻,这种误差比较小了。

2, 在电容C10通过9012CB放电时,会剩余0.6V左右的电压,并且会随着温度而变化,不过对精度影响稍微大点

如此简单的电路,要求不太高的场合特别推荐啊
oufuqiang
3楼-- · 2020-01-23 06:46
电容放电是通过IO不是三极管。
liumaojun_cn
4楼-- · 2020-01-23 11:23
mark
zhangjinxing
5楼-- · 2020-01-23 11:30
通过IO啊,也没个限流电阻,
10uf电容通过IO放电,放电瞬间电流蛮大,证明89c2051还不错嘛
wxfhw
6楼-- · 2020-01-23 15:00
 精彩回答 2  元偷偷看……

一周热门 更多>